The Swiss Bankers Association released a white paper on how Swiss banks can assistance the improvement of the country’s digital economy. A Swiss franc “joint” deposit token is the answer the group settled on.
Stablecoins have restricted penetration in the Swiss economic program, even as finish-to-finish digitization is becoming much more popular in enterprise models, and no Swiss stablecoins are accessible by the common public, the paper says.
The authors of the paper recommend a assortment of stablecoins — that is, a deposit token “issued by regulated and adequately supervised intermediaries” — issued and redeemed by wise contracts and denominated in Swiss francs. The token could be created as a ledger-primarily based safety, rather than a set of guidelines, to offer it with the greatest prospective.
The paper identifies 3 design and style solutions for a deposit token: Standardized tokens that any industrial bank can situation with a uniform normal, colored tokens that are issued by industrial banks to any requirements they decide on, and joint tokens that are issued by a licensed and supervised particular goal automobile consisting of participating banks. The authors choose the final option.

A joint deposit token would facilitate revenue creation due to its flexibility, have low charges and could earn interest when held in bank accounts. It would be significantly less liable to runs than tokens issued by person banks. In addition:
“From a technical standpoint, all the financial and legal specifications that have been identified can be met. […] In principle, the DT should really operate on a public blockchain with more protocols to make certain enough privacy and transaction efficiency.”
The token would ideally be a layer-two answer usable in decentralized finance (DeFi) applications and capable of self-custody or bank custody.
Deposit tokens are a relative newcomer to the ranks of digital currencies. According to a current overview in The Washington Post, they originated in Project Guardian, an initiative the Monetary Authority of Singapore launched with a number of economic institutions in Could 2022 that sought to discover DeFi applications in wholesale funding markets.

JPMorgan, one particular of the participants in Project Guardian, executed the initially DeFi trade on a public blockchain as portion of that project. JPMorgan and project participant Oliver Wyman released a paper discussing the merits of deposit token technologies in February.
